gpt4 book ai didi

sql - SQL 表的大小取决于什么?

转载 作者:搜寻专家 更新时间:2023-10-30 19:56:03 25 4
gpt4 key购买 nike

<分区>

我的意思是这里的 SQL 可以是任何类似 SQL 的数据库,例如 SQL Server、My SQL、SQLite,甚至是 MS Access。我想知道表格的大小取决于什么,它取决于具有固定设计结构的表格中的实际行,或者它还取决于表格中单元格的内容。例如:

我有一个表,它有这样固定设计的结构:

create table SampleTable (
ID int primary key,
Message varchar(500)
)

这是有 1 行的表格:

ID    |     Message
1 I love .NET --11 characters for Message

这里还有一个只有 1 行的表格:

ID    |     Message
1 I also love Java --16 characters for Message

如果大小取决于行数,则上面的 2 个表将具有相同的大小,如果它还取决于单元格的内容,则第二个表将具有更大的大小。我想知道哪个大?我关心这个是因为,在某些情况下,我真的想最大化一个字段的最大字符数(SQL Server 中为 8000),以使用户无需输入他/她想要的几乎任何内容,但我害怕制作我的数据库文件太大(不必要的,成本高)。

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com